Deped releases Transmutation Table for Schools without Fourth Quarter Exam

The Department of Education (DepEd) has released DepEd Memorandum No. 42, s. 2020 titled Guidelines for the Remainder of School Year 2019-2020 In Light of COVID-19 Measures. This memorandum also provides the Transmutation table and a sample computation of the Fourth Quarter Grades  for Schools without examination.



Grading and transmutation formula shall be adopted for the evaluation of the final grades of the affected learners

For the schools, or classes within schools, prevented from administering the 4th Quarter Examination, as described in paragraph 4 (b) above, the following grading and transmutation formula shall be adopted for the evaluation of the final grades of the affected learners:

a. DepEd Order No. 8, s. 2015 titled Policy Guidelines on Classroom Assessment for the K to 12 Basic Education Program shall still be the basis in computing the Fourth Quarter grade of the learners, except that it will be based on class standing (CS) composed of written works and performance tasks.

b. Livelihood/Sports/Arts and Design track in the Senior High School (SHS), CS totals 80% in original formula. Upon computing the weighted score in each component, the CS grade will be transmuted using Table 1 in Enclosure No. 2 to get the Fourth Quarter Grade.

c. For all core subjects in the SHS as well as Work Immersion/Research/ Business Enterprise/Simulation/Exhibit/Performance in the Academic Track, CS totals 75% in original formula. Upon computing the weighted score in each component, the CS grade will be transmuted using Table 2 in Enclosure No. 2 to get the Fourth Quarter Grade.

d. For all other subjects in the Academic Track of SHS, CS totals 70% in original formula. Upon computing the weighted score in each component, the CS grade will be transmuted using Table 3 in Enclosure No. 2 to get the Fourth Quarter Grade

e. A sample computation of Fourth Quarter Grade is provided in Enclosure No. 3.
